We are motivated to avoid using a bitfield for obj->active for a couple
of reasons. Firstly, we wish to document our lockless read of obj->active
using READ_ONCE inside i915_gem_busy_ioctl() and that requires an
integral type (i.e. not a bitfield). Secondly, gcc produces abysmal code
when presented with a bitfield and that shows up high on the profiles of
request tracking (mainly due to excess memory traffic as it converts
the bitfield to a register and back and generates frequent AGI in the
process).

diff --git a/drivers/gpu/drm/i915/i915_drv.h b/drivers/gpu/drm/i915/i915_drv.h
index efa43411f0eb..1ecff535973e 100644
--- a/drivers/gpu/drm/i915/i915_drv.h
+++ b/drivers/gpu/drm/i915/i915_drv.h
@@ -2031,12 +2031,16 @@ struct drm_i915_gem_object {
 
        struct list_head batch_pool_link;
 
+       unsigned long flags;
        /**
         * This is set if the object is on the active lists (has pending
         * rendering and so a non-zero seqno), and is not set if it i s on
         * inactive (ready to be unbound) list.
         */
-       unsigned int active:I915_NUM_RINGS;
+#define I915_BO_ACTIVE_SHIFT 0
+#define I915_BO_ACTIVE_MASK ((1 << I915_NUM_RINGS) - 1)
+#define I915_BO_ACTIVE(bo) ((bo)->flags & (I915_BO_ACTIVE_MASK << 
I915_BO_ACTIVE_SHIFT))
+#define __I915_BO_ACTIVE(bo) (READ_ONCE((bo)->flags) & (I915_BO_ACTIVE_MASK << 
I915_BO_ACTIVE_SHIFT))
 
        /**
         * This is set if the object has been written to since last bound
@@ -2151,6 +2155,31 @@ struct drm_i915_gem_object {
 #define GEM_BUG_ON(expr)
 #endif
 
+static inline bool
+i915_gem_object_is_active(const struct drm_i915_gem_object *obj)
+{
+       return obj->flags & (I915_BO_ACTIVE_MASK << I915_BO_ACTIVE_SHIFT);
+}
+
+static inline void
+i915_gem_object_set_active(struct drm_i915_gem_object *obj, int engine)
+{
+       obj->flags |= 1 << (engine + I915_BO_ACTIVE_SHIFT);
+}
+
+static inline void
+i915_gem_object_unset_active(struct drm_i915_gem_object *obj, int engine)
+{
+       obj->flags &= ~(1 << (engine + I915_BO_ACTIVE_SHIFT));
+}
+
+static inline bool
+i915_gem_object_has_active_engine(const struct drm_i915_gem_object *obj,
+                                 int engine)
+{
+       return obj->flags & (1 << (engine + I915_BO_ACTIVE_SHIFT));
+}
+
 void i915_gem_track_fb(struct drm_i915_gem_object *old,
                       struct drm_i915_gem_object *new,
                       unsigned frontbuffer_bits);
